Blackmagic Design has launched a new 6K digital camera, the Blackmagic Design Blackmagic URSA Broadcast G2. The company proclaims the G2 is three cameras in one, pointing to the fact that it can work as a 4K production camera, a 4K studio camera or a 6K digital film camera.

Blackmagic Design fits a 6K sensor into the Blackmagic URSA Broadcast G2

The camera’s new 6144 x 3456 digital film sensor offers 13 stops of dynamic range and uses Blackmagic’s generation 5 color science. It also has a dual gain ISO from -12dB (100 ISO) to +36dB (25,600 ISO). This means that the camera should capture high-quality videos in low light.

The Blackmagic URSA Broadcast G2 features a B4 lens mount

The camera comes with a fitted B4 lens mount as standard. Due to the dimensions of the B4 mount, you have to use a 4K window of the sensor to use the camera for Ultra HD broadcasts. However, the camera supplies a user swappable EF mount which allows you to shoot in full 6K. PL and F mounts are also available as optional accessories.

Here are the Blackmagic URSA Broadcast’s storage and file format options

With the Blackmagic Design Blackmagic URSA Broadcast G2, you can record to SD cards, UHS-II cards, CFast 2.0 cards or external USB disks. The file formats on offer are H.265, Apple ProRes and Blackmagic RAW. When shooting in H.265, you can record very small files — with 60:1 to 285:1 compression ratios — yet still retain 10-bit broadcast quality.

ND filters

The Blackmagic Design Blackmagic URSA Broadcast G2 shares a body design with Blackmagic Design’s URSA Mini Pro range of cameras. It also shares great features such as internal 1/4, 1/16th and 1/64th stop ND filters. These ND filters will evenly filter both optical and IR wavelengths to eliminate IR contamination.

Blackmagic Design Davinci Resolve comes with the camera

The Blackmagic Design Blackmagic URSA Broadcast G2 comes with Blackmagic’s shoulder mount kit, V-Lock battery plate and top handle. You need to buy these accessories separately for the other cameras in the Ursa range, so it’s a good saving. The full studio version of Davinci Resolve comes with the camera as well.

Extra accessories

Other optional accessories available include zoom and focus demands, which you can use to control photography lenses for live production. The new camera is compatible with the Blackmagic Design URSA Viewfinder and Blackmagic Design URSA Studio Viewfinder.

Pricing and availability

The Blackmagic Design Blackmagic URSA Broadcast G2 retails for $3,995 and is available now.
